分布式云服务器与分布式服务器:互联网技术的革新
一、分布式云服务器的概念与特点
随着互联网的快速发展,数据量的爆炸式增长以及对计算资源的需求不断提高,传统的集中式服务器架构已经难以满足现代应用的需求。分布式云服务器作为一种新型的云计算架构,应运而生。
分布式云服务器是将云计算的资源和服务分布在多个地理位置的服务器上,通过网络将这些资源连接起来,形成一个统一的资源池。这种架构具有以下几个显著特点:
1. 高可靠性:分布式云服务器通过将数据和计算任务分布在多个服务器上,避免了单点故障的风险。即使某个服务器出现故障,其他服务器可以继续提供服务,确保业务的连续性。
2. 可扩展性:分布式云服务器可以根据业务需求动态地增加或减少服务器资源,实现弹性扩展。这种可扩展性使得企业能够更好地应对业务的增长和变化,避免了资源的浪费。
3. 高性能:分布式云服务器通过将计算任务分配到多个服务器上并行处理,提高了系统的整体性能。同时,分布式存储技术可以提高数据的读写速度,进一步提升系统的性能。
4. 灵活性:分布式云服务器可以根据不同的应用需求,灵活地配置服务器资源,提供定制化的服务。企业可以根据自己的业务特点选择合适的计算、存储和网络资源,提高资源的利用率。
二、分布式服务器的工作原理与优势
分布式服务器是一种将服务器资源分布在多个节点上的架构,通过网络进行协同工作,共同完成服务请求。分布式服务器的工作原理主要包括以下几个方面:
1. 任务分配:分布式服务器系统会将接收到的服务请求分配到不同的节点上进行处理。通过合理的任务分配算法,可以确保各个节点的负载均衡,提高系统的整体性能。
2. 数据分布:为了提高数据的访问效率和可靠性,分布式服务器会将数据分布在多个节点上进行存储。通过数据分片和副本技术,可以实现数据的快速读写和容错处理。
3. 协同工作:各个节点之间通过网络进行通信和协同工作,共同完成服务请求。节点之间会进行信息交换和协调,确保系统的一致性和正确性。
分布式服务器具有以下几个优势:
1. 提高系统的可靠性:通过将服务器资源分布在多个节点上,避免了单点故障的风险。即使某个节点出现故障,其他节点可以继续提供服务,保证系统的正常运行。
2. 增强系统的可扩展性:分布式服务器可以根据业务需求灵活地增加或减少节点数量,实现系统的横向扩展。这种可扩展性使得系统能够更好地适应业务的增长和变化。
3. 提高系统的性能:通过将任务分配到多个节点上并行处理,以及优化数据分布和访问策略,可以提高系统的整体性能,缩短服务响应时间。
4. 降低成本:分布式服务器可以充分利用现有硬件资源,通过资源共享和优化配置,降低系统的建设和运营成本。
三、分布式云服务器与分布式服务器的应用场景
分布式云服务器和分布式服务器在许多领域都有广泛的应用,以下是一些常见的应用场景:
1. 大数据处理:随着数据量的不断增长,大数据处理成为了一个重要的挑战。分布式云服务器和分布式服务器可以提供强大的计算和存储能力,支持大规模数据的并行处理和分析,如数据挖掘、机器学习等。
2. 云计算服务:分布式云服务器是云计算的重要组成部分,为用户提供弹性的计算、存储和网络资源。云计算服务提供商可以通过分布式云服务器架构,实现资源的高效管理和分配,为用户提供高质量的服务。
3. 网站和应用托管:对于高流量的网站和应用,分布式服务器可以提供更好的性能和可靠性。通过将服务器资源分布在多个节点上,可以有效地应对突发流量和高并发请求,保证网站和应用的正常运行。
4. 游戏服务器:在线游戏需要处理大量的玩家数据和实时交互,分布式服务器可以提供低延迟、高并发的服务,为玩家提供流畅的游戏体验。
5. 企业信息化:企业内部的信息化系统,如 ERP、CRM 等,需要处理大量的业务数据和用户请求。分布式服务器可以提供可靠的服务和高性能的计算能力,满足企业信息化的需求。
四、分布式云服务器与分布式服务器的发展趋势
随着技术的不断进步和应用需求的不断增长,分布式云服务器和分布式服务器的发展呈现出以下几个趋势:
1. 智能化:随着人工智能技术的发展,分布式云服务器和分布式服务器将更加智能化。通过引入机器学习和自动化管理技术,可以实现资源的智能分配、故障的自动诊断和修复,提高系统的管理效率和可靠性。
2. 边缘计算:随着物联网的发展,边缘计算成为了一个重要的趋势。分布式服务器将更加靠近数据源和用户,实现数据的实时处理和响应,减少数据传输的延迟和带宽消耗。
3. 混合云架构:企业在数字化转型过程中,往往需要同时使用公有云和私有云资源。分布式云服务器和分布式服务器可以支持混合云架构,实现公有云和私有云资源的统一管理和调度,提高资源的利用率和灵活性。
4. 安全增强:随着网络安全威胁的不断增加,分布式云服务器和分布式服务器将更加注重安全防护。通过采用加密技术、访问控制、安全监测等手段,保障系统的安全性和数据的保密性。
五、结论
分布式云服务器和分布式服务器作为互联网技术的重要发展方向,为企业和用户提供了更高效、可靠、灵活的计算和存储资源。随着技术的不断进步和应用场景的不断拓展,分布式云服务器和分布式服务器将在未来的互联网发展中发挥更加重要的作用。企业和开发者应积极关注这一技术的发展趋势,充分利用分布式云服务器和分布式服务器的优势,推动业务的创新和发展。